Should You Buy a 1992 Kawasaki Ninja 1000?

The 1992 Kawasaki Ninja 1000 is a touring motorcycle that combines performance with comfort, making it an appealing choice for riders seeking long-distance travel without sacrificing power. With a robust 0.997L engine producing 92 hp, it delivers a thrilling ride while maintaining the reliability expected from the Ninja lineage. Although specific details on torque, fuel economy, and transmission are not available, the Ninja 1000 is known for its smooth handling and responsive acceleration, making it suitable for both city commuting and highway cruising. Riders can expect a motorcycle that balances sportiness with touring capabilities, ideal for those who enjoy extended rides on varied terrains.

Potential buyers should be aware that while the Ninja 1000 is a well-regarded model, it lacks detailed complaint data from the NHTSA, which may indicate a solid reputation among owners. However, prospective buyers should still conduct thorough inspections and consider the motorcycle's maintenance history to ensure a reliable purchase.
